Common Questions About the Average American Womens Sizing Guide

Q: Why do sizes vary so much between brands?
A: Sizing inconsistency often stems from differing regional standards, proprietary sizing formulas, and variations in waist vs. bust measurement emphasis. Brands may use proprietary charts or follow industry averages with slight tweaks, leading to discrepancies readers might encounter when comparing garments.

Q: How accurate are ready-to-wear sizes?
A: While convenient, mass-produced sizes reflect typical averages and can misfit those outside typical ranges. Understanding body dimensions rather than just numbers helps personalize fit beyond arbitrary labels.

Q: Does sizing differ by body type?
A: Yes—womens’ bodies vary significantly in proportions. The guide emphasizes reviewing measurements specific to fit needs (e.g., waist-to-hip ratio) rather than relying solely on size labels, to accommodate diverse shapes comfortably.

Q: Should I prioritize comfort over matching a label perfectly?
A: While labels offer a starting point, personal fit—adjusted for activity, posture, and preferred comfort—often supersedes strict size adherence. The guide encourages listening to how clothing feels during wear.

Q: How can I find my best size if traditional charts don’t work?
A: The guide recommends using body measurements to cross-check garments, trying items in-store when possible, and selecting sizes with slightly roomier waist or hip room to allow flexibility in fit.
